ok, one more PrBoom-Plus question :-).

The soulshpere is set to semi-transparant by default.
1:
How do I turn this off and turn it on for some of my own sprites?
Is it possible to do this in the Dehacked file?

2:
Is it possible for wall textures as well?

dehacked files with the .bex extension can make objects translucent.

If your map is in Boom format, the Linedef Action 260 will make the middle texture of that line translucent.
